    In March of 2024, one of the most exciting new brands launched in the world of Independent Haute Horlogerie: Renaud Tixier. A combination of experience, expertise, unbridled talent and creativity, Renaud Tixier is the company created by Dominique Renaud and Julien Tixier. However, a company of talented craftsmen needs leadership to develop as a successful brand with a long-term strategy. Espcecially if it is to claim an important seat at the top table in the world of luxury watchmaking. This is the role of the CEO. We are delighted to welcome out guest for this episode of Keeping Time, Michel Nieto, CEO Renaud Tixier.

    Join us as we learn about the incredible success stories which Mr Nieto has quietly steered, including rebuilding global brands for Richemont and developing strategies for success such as the award-winning Bulgari Octo Finissimo collection. We first met Michel in Geneve this year, at the bar of the Beau-Rivage hotel. This podcast is a continuation of that conversation with the highly engaging, focused and delightful Michel. Albeit without gin and tonics in hand, the conversation on this episode picks right up where we left off in Geneve and delves into Michel's storied career and leads us into how he engaged with the talented team of Dominque Renaud and Julien Tixier.

    Naturally, the conversation turns to a focus on the breakthrough introductory watch, Renaud Tixier "Monday" and Mr Nieto gives us insight and technical details of this remarkable debut timepiece. We discuss the working methods of the two watchmakers, the incredible background of Dominique Renaud, founder of Renaud & Papi which was to become APRP (Audemars Piguet, Renaud & Papi). We discuss the incredible, prodigious talent of Julien Tixier and hear a very bold claim by Michel on the importance of this young watchmaker.     Our guest on Keeping Time with Oster Watches episode is a highly talented and passionate watchmaker, Felipe Pikullik. Based in Berlin, Germany, of Brazilian descent, Felipe embodies all that is celebrated in the Art of Watchmaking. Each piece that bears the Felipe Pikullik brand name is a demonstration of purity, dedication and tradition - a classical approach to contemporary watchmaking. Signature sculpted bridges are formed within the atelier and embellished with traditional finishing techniques long recognized as all that embodies haute horlogerie. Felipe and his team transform each caliber produced with impeccable craftsmanship and a commitment to excellence.

    Welcome back everyone as we kick off our 8th Season of Keeping Time! We are thrilled to kick off the new season with a very special guest, Bernhard Lederer. Mr. Lederer is a highly accomplished Master Watchmaker with many decades of experience creating and achieving complicated and challenging timepieces, including ground-breaking clocks and remarkable wristwatches. The most recent project is the GPHG Award-Winning Central Impulse Chronometer. Claiming the 2021 GPHG Award in the Innovation category, Lederer Watches has achieved one of the holy grails of watchmaking. Whilst it can be said that this watch furthers the work of George Daniels, Mr Lederer has innovated and challenged the notion of a modern wristwatch chronometer.

    Join us as we welcome Claude back to the podcast. Our most regularly featured guest, Claude is welcomed back for a second time this season with news of another brand new model. Listen in as the always engaging Master Watchmaker, Claude Greisler, discusses the recently unveiled Armin Strom One Week. As the name suggests, the new model has a power reserve of one full week. Based on a caliber originally launched by the brand a decade ago, Claude talks us through all the changes, modifications and aesthetic choices made by the brand as Armin Strom unveils this important addition to the expanding collection offered by the Manufacture today.

    Claude shares technical details and further insights into his incredible company, Armin Strom, co-founded by Claude Greisler and Serge Michel.
